Karli

Karli is a village located in the Rayagada Subdivision of Rayagada district,Odisha, India. Karli has a population of 177 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Gumma Gram Panchayat and the Rayagada Block Panchayat in Rayagada District. The village has 40 households and is identified by village code 426311. Karli is located in the 765002 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Rayagada Sub-District.

Total Population of Karli

As of the 2011 census, Population of Karli has a population of approximately 177 people, where the male population is 78 and the female population is 99.

Total 177
Male 78
Female 99
